Differences between AE and Cadet Compass tests

Cant see that this has been addressed specifically in this post, can any AE applicants offer insight? My understanding is that the Compass test for AE is slightly different from the cadet version and consists of the following:

Slalom
Orientation
maths test
flight control (with the rudder and VSI)
Short term memory (headings, alts etc)
a Multi tasking exercise
*physics test

Can anyone confirm if this is correct, im particularly unsure about the physics test.
